Output 3bfc66f82bfb1668a25f9c57ce678a686e98af5e62189d616bdf437e4d8be5dd:0

value
660740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 709a75c8fa2c8b0883e550f54768a795c2aaf9a2 OP_EQUAL
address
3BxQe71pr2UoqfhVQgScsowkRHYi6e1wXY
transaction
3bfc66f82bfb1668a25f9c57ce678a686e98af5e62189d616bdf437e4d8be5dd
confirmations
358817
spent
true